Brazil beat China by 3 sets at 0 on Thursday (26), in the second stage of the Men’s League of Volleyball (VNL) 2025. The confrontation took place in Hoffman Estates, United States. The partials were 25-22, 25-16 and 25-23.

How was Brazil x China in the League of Men’s Volleyball Nations

In the first set, Brazil even opened a difference of five points (15-10), but saw China touch and be at a point of the draw (21-20). Despite the fright, the Brazilians won by 25-22.

In the second set, the selection controlled the match again and built a good advantage on the scoreboard (21-14). The last point was marked after an attack by Arthur Bento, closing on 25-16.

In the third set, China showed reaction power and made it difficult for the Brazilian victory to open 15-11. Brazil, led by Honorato, Flávio and Alan, resumed control of the match and closed with Adriano on 25-23.

With the victory, Brazil went to 1st place, with 15 points. The team faces Italy on Saturday (28) at 18h. China, in 15th place with seven points, also takes Italy, but on Friday (27), at 18h.
